Bears Face No. 6 Gustavus Adolphus in Quarterfinals
The No. 5 Washington University in St. Louis men's tennis team battles No. 6 Gustavus Adolphus College in the 2008 NCAA Division III Quarterfinals at on Tuesday, May 13, at 6 p.m. (ET), in Lewiston, Maine. Washington U. is making its fifth-appearance in the quarterfinals.

WU Track & Field Meets Seven NCAA Provisional Times
The Washington University men’s and women’s track and field teams met seven NCAA Division III Outdoor Championship provisional qualifying times at the two-day Dr. Keeler Invitational on the campus of North Central College in Naperville, Ill., on Thursday-Friday, May 8-9.

Lehmann and Kennedy Named Academic All-District
Juniors Zander Lehmann and Gregg Kennedy of the Washington University baseball team were named to the 2008 ESPN the Magazine College Division Academic All-District VII team, as selected by the College Sports Information Directors of America (CoSIDA). Lehmann was a first-team selection, while Kennedy was named to the second team.



Kreitman, Vukovich Honored by ESPN The Magazine
Junior infielder Kerry Kreitman and senior outfielder Amy Vukovich (right) of the No. 16 Washington University in St. Louis softball team were named to the 2008 ESPN the Magazine College Division Academic All-District VII First Team, as selected by the College Sports Information Directors of America (CoSIDA).
